Output 73c27cda30a417a1909424a2ac4c4c4b357762da49861511b5461e2ba25f0765:104

value
81174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a94f521bba36f7052b0a46453b172429ff096c55 OP_EQUAL
address
3H8F9GHmjcc4ezZhDBD2mVuuNM5YST7K2p
transaction
73c27cda30a417a1909424a2ac4c4c4b357762da49861511b5461e2ba25f0765
spent
true